In recent years, vaping has become increasingly popular among Filipino youth and adults, leading to a substantial demand for diverse vaping gear. This shift can be attributed to a multitude of factors, including the perception of vaping as a safer alternative to traditional smoking. Furthermore, the social aspect of vaping—where users often congregate in vape shops or lounges—has fostered a community around this lifestyle. As a result, local entrepreneurs have seized the opportunity to offer a variety of vaping products tailored to the preferences of Filipino consumers.
The Filipino vaping gear market features a wide range of products, from basic e-cigarettes to advanced personal vaporizers and an array of flavored e-liquids. Local brands have emerged, promoting their products as not only affordable but also of high quality, catering to the unique tastes of the Filipino palate. The introduction of flavors inspired by local fruits, such as mango and calamansi, has resonated with consumers, driving sales and creating a sense of cultural pride among users.
However, the surge in vaping popularity has raised concerns regarding health implications and regulatory measures. The Philippine government has responded with mixed policies; while some regulations aim to restrict sales to minors and impose advertising limitations, there is also a push to recognize vaping as a less harmful alternative to smoking. This dichotomy presents challenges for both consumers and businesses, as they navigate the landscape of health risks and regulatory compliance.
